Greyhound Racing Victoria held the first of three regional Stakeholder Engagement Workshops on Wednesday, 6 October, at Shepparton to explore thoughts and views on what can be done to ensure all greyhounds have a successful racing career and are re-homed.

A total of 48 of the 58 greyhounds given first-round invitations to the Group 1 Sky Racing Topgun or Group 2 Stayers Topgun have accepted, with the final fields to be announced on Sky Racing’s The Catching Pen on Tuesday, October 11, at 6.30pm.
